I would be honored to work closely with you on a custom commission through Hyde Parks Art Center’s Not Just Another Pretty Face. NJAPF is the Art Center’s matchmaking commissioning program for artists and potential art buyers, facilitating lasting relationships between artists and patrons, a new base of support for artists, and investment in the vitality of Chicago’s cultural community.
